This is a 1993 FBIS press summary detailing political and infrastructure news from Beijing, including statements by Li Peng regarding Mao Zedong and railway construction plans.

This document is a press summary compiled by the Foreign Broadcast Information Service (FBIS) in Okinawa, dated December 8, 1993. It provides highlights from major Beijing-based newspapers as reported by Xinhua. The summary notes that Chinese Premier Li Peng praised Mao Zedong for his contributions to China's diplomatic strategy and foreign policies during a symposium. Additionally, the report mentions that China planned to invest 12 billion yuan into the construction of the Beijing-Jiulong (Kowloon) railway in 1994 to ensure the project's completion by the end of 1995, serving as a new link between the Chinese capital and Hong Kong. Finally, the document briefly identifies Hu Jintao as a senior official of the Chinese Communist Party.
